GMC ENVOY 2009  Owners Manual Headphones
The RSE system includes two sets of wireless
headphones.
Each set of headphones has an ON/OFF control. An
indicator light illuminates on the headphones when they

GMC ENVOY 2009  Owners Manual Stereo RCA Jacks
The RCA jacks are located behind the video screen.
The RCA jacks allow audio and video signals to

GMC ENVOY 2009  Owners Manual DVD Player Buttons (Without Sunroof)
O(Power):Press to turn the RSE system on and off.
The power indicator light illuminates when the power
is on.
X(Eject):Press to eject a DVD or CD.

GMC ENVOY 2009  Owners Manual Remote Control Buttons
O(Power):Press to turn the DVD player on and off.
v(Title):Press to return the DVD to the main
menu of the DVD.
